To identify noisy plumbing, it is important to establish first whether the undesirable noises happen on the system's inlet side-in other words, when water is transformed on-or on the drainpipe side. Noises on the inlet side have varied reasons: excessive water pressure, worn valve and tap parts, incorrectly attached pumps or various other appliances, inaccurately put pipeline fasteners, as well as plumbing runs including way too many tight bends or other restrictions. Sounds on the drain side normally stem from bad location or, similar to some inlet side noise, a design containing tight bends.
Hissing
Hissing noise that occurs when a tap is opened somewhat typically signals excessive water pressure. Consult your regional water company if you presume this problem; it will certainly be able to tell you the water pressure in your area and can install a pressurereducing shutoff on the inbound supply of water pipe if needed.
Other Inlet Side Noises
Creaking, squealing, scratching, breaking, and also tapping typically are brought on by the development or tightening of pipelines, normally copper ones providing warm water. The noises happen as the pipes slide against loose bolts or strike close-by home framework. You can often pinpoint the location of the issue if the pipelines are subjected; just follow the sound when the pipelines are making sounds. Probably you will certainly uncover a loosened pipe wall mount or a location where pipes lie so close to floor joists or other mounting items that they clatter versus them. Connecting foam pipeline insulation around the pipelines at the point of get in touch with must correct the issue. Make certain straps and also wall mounts are secure as well as offer adequate support. Where feasible, pipe fasteners should be affixed to huge structural components such as structure walls rather than to mounting; doing so decreases the transmission of resonances from plumbing to surface areas that can amplify as well as transfer them. If connecting fasteners to framework is inescapable, wrap pipes with insulation or various other resilient product where they get in touch with bolts, as well as sandwich the ends of brand-new bolts between rubber washing machines when mounting them.
Correcting plumbing runs that suffer from flow-restricting limited or countless bends is a last option that should be embarked on only after getting in touch with a competent plumbing specialist. However, this scenario is rather usual in older residences that may not have been constructed with indoor plumbing or that have actually seen numerous remodels, especially by novices.
Chattering or Screeching
Intense chattering or screeching that takes place when a shutoff or tap is turned on, and that generally disappears when the fitting is opened fully, signals loose or faulty inner parts. The remedy is to replace the shutoff or tap with a brand-new one.
Pumps as well as appliances such as washing devices and dish washers can transfer electric motor noise to pipes if they are poorly attached. Connect such items to plumbing with plastic or rubber hoses-never rigid pipe-to isolate them.
Drainpipe Noise
On the drainpipe side of plumbing, the principal objectives are to eliminate surfaces that can be struck by falling or rushing water as well as to protect pipelines to have unavoidable audios.
In new building and construction, tubs, shower stalls, commodes, as well as wallmounted sinks as well as containers ought to be set on or versus resistant underlayments to lower the transmission of audio through them. Water-saving toilets and also faucets are much less loud than traditional models; install them rather than older types even if codes in your area still permit using older fixtures.
Drains that do not run vertically to the basement or that branch right into horizontal pipe runs sustained at flooring joists or various other mounting existing specifically frustrating sound problems. Such pipes are huge sufficient to emit significant resonance; they also bring significant quantities of water, which makes the situation worse. In new building, specify cast-iron soil pipelines (the big pipes that drain toilets) if you can manage them. Their massiveness consists of a lot of the sound made by water passing through them. Also, stay clear of directing drainpipes in walls shown to rooms as well as areas where individuals gather. Walls consisting of drainpipes must be soundproofed as was explained earlier, making use of double panels of sound-insulating fiber board as well as wallboard. Pipes themselves can be covered with special fiberglass insulation made for the purpose; such pipelines have a resistant vinyl skin (occasionally consisting of lead). Outcomes are not constantly sufficient.
Thudding
Thudding noise, often accompanied by trembling pipelines, when a tap or appliance valve is turned off is a problem called water hammer. The sound and also resonance are triggered by the resounding wave of pressure in the water, which instantly has no place to go. Occasionally opening a shutoff that releases water promptly right into an area of piping having a limitation, joint, or tee installation can produce the very same problem.
Water hammer can usually be cured by installing installations called air chambers or shock absorbers in the plumbing to which the problem valves or faucets are attached. These devices allow the shock wave produced by the halted circulation of water to dissipate in the air they include, which (unlike water) is compressible.
Older plumbing systems may have short upright sections of capped pipeline behind wall surfaces on tap competes the exact same purpose; these can ultimately fill with water, lowering or ruining their efficiency. The treatment is to drain pipes the water supply entirely by shutting down the primary water system shutoff and opening up all faucets. Then open up the major supply shutoff and close the taps one by one, beginning with the faucet nearest the valve as well as finishing with the one farthest away.
WHY IS MY PLUMBING MAKING SO MUCH NOISE?
This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.
To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.

Cracks or Ticks
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.
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.
Bangs
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
